Heraklion is not a port day to leave vague. It is denser, older, and better when you give the stop a clear storyline. The obvious headline is Knossos, the Minoan Bronze Age site tied to frescoes, throne-room drama, and the labyrinth legend. The smarter move is to treat Knossos as the opening chapter, not the whole book. Pair it with the Heraklion Archaeological Museum and the city starts to feel less like a transit point and more like the place where Crete's deep past snaps into focus.
For cruise passengers, Heraklion works because several strong stops sit close enough to build a realistic day. You can go ancient with Knossos, stay central with the archaeological museum and Lion Square, or keep the plan low-friction around Koules Fortress and the harbor. Families have an easy indoor fallback at the Natural History Museum, while history completists can add the Historical Museum of Crete. The main trap is overloading the day. Pick one anchor, add one or two nearby layers, and leave space for the city to feel like a place rather than a checklist.

Knossos Palace is the stop that makes Heraklion feel essential on a Mediterranean itinerary. The site is close enough for a port day, with a bus ride from the port listed at about 15 minutes, but it still deserves mental bandwidth. Go for the Minoan ruins, frescoes, iconic throne room, and the labyrinth legend that gives the place its mythic charge. This is best for travelers who want the big cultural headline, not a casual wander. An audio guide makes sense here, because the site can feel like a maze in more ways than one.

The Heraklion Archaeological Museum is the rare museum that feels like an upgrade to a ruins visit, not a separate homework assignment. Its Minoan artifacts, including the snake goddess and bull-leaping friezes, give shape and color to what you have just seen or are about to see at Knossos. Because it sits in the city center and offers climate control, it is also a practical cruise-day pivot if you want substance without more transit. Prioritize it if you care about context, design, ancient objects, or simply want the clearest indoor counterpoint to the palace.

Koules Fortress is the easy win near the water: a Venetian sea bastion beside the port, with cannons, a lighthouse, and bay views that look good even on a compressed schedule. It is not the deepest history stop in Heraklion, but it is visually satisfying and very cruise-friendly because it does not require you to commit the whole day. Add it before or after a museum, or use it as the main event if you want a simple harbor walk with a clear sense of place. It fits photographers, casual history people, and anyone avoiding a busier inland plan.

Morosini Fountain, better known through its Lion Square setting, is where the day can stop being all ruins and start feeling social. The 17th-century lion-spout fountain gives you a real landmark, but the appeal is the surrounding pedestrian zone, cafe rhythm, and easy gelato pause nearby. It is a strong add-on, not necessarily a sole reason to book a Heraklion call. Use it to break up museum time, meet back with your group, or give the itinerary a softer city-center middle. If Knossos is the serious chapter, Lion Square is the palate cleanser.

The Natural History Museum is the practical pick when your group needs something more interactive than another ancient site. Its mix of dinosaurs, fossils, themed rooms, and Minoan ecology gives kids plenty to latch onto, and the affordable, indoor setup makes it a useful fallback during a packed port day. It is not the signature Heraklion experience, so first-timers with a strong appetite for archaeology should still look at Knossos and the archaeological museum first. But for families, mixed-age groups, or anyone museum-hopping with limited patience, this can be the stop that keeps the day intact.

The Historical Museum of Crete is for travelers who do not want Heraklion reduced to the Minoans alone. It is compact, air-conditioned, and within walking distance, with El Greco paintings, Byzantine icons, and a model of Arkadi Monastery adding later layers to the island's story. Think of it as a smart second museum rather than the obvious first stop. It pairs well with a central wander or Koules Fortress, especially if you prefer smaller collections over one blockbuster site. Choose it when you want context without spending the entire call in transit or crowds.

Agia Triada Church is the niche pick: tiny frescoed chapel ruins near a beach, reached by a short taxi ride and suited to travelers who want a softer, quieter edge to the day. The Byzantine art and peaceful setting sound appealing, but this is not the first priority if you have never seen Knossos or the main museum. It works best after you have already covered Heraklion's headline history on a previous visit, or if your group wants a low-key seaside picnic atmosphere with a small cultural stop attached. Treat it as a mood choice, not a must-do.
